Property is move-in ready.
This 1914 Craftsman is in move-in ready condition with significant recent updates that blend historic charm with modern functionality. Key improvements include a 2021 kitchen renovation with newer GE appliances and LVP flooring, a modernized bathroom featuring radiant heated floors, and the addition of two detached studios built in 2019. The interior features fresh paint and well-maintained original hardwoods. While the home is historic, the major living areas and systems have been updated within the last 5-10 years, meeting the criteria for a high-quality, well-maintained property.
Two 2019-built detached studios with an additional 3/4 bath provide over 240 sqft of flexible space, ideal for a home office, guest suite, or potential rental income.
Situated on a private dead-end street adjacent to Hutchinson Park with only one neighbor, the home offers rare seclusion and scenic views of Lake Washington and the Seattle skyline.
This 1914 Craftsman blends original character with high-end updates, including radiant heated bathroom floors, a 2021 kitchen remodel, and professional exterior maintenance.
The primary residence contains only one bathroom, which may be a significant drawback for families or buyers seeking a traditional primary suite.
The assigned neighborhood schools, including the adjacent elementary and local high school, currently hold low performance ratings, which could impact long-term resale value.
